Summary
TLDRThis transcript covers immigration and refugee management issues in Aceh, Indonesia, focusing on the efforts of the regional immigration office to monitor and prevent human trafficking, and manage foreigner-related matters. It highlights the operations of various immigration offices, the challenges in overseeing vast geographical areas, and the increasing presence of Rohingya refugees fleeing violence in Myanmar. Public concerns, mixed reactions, and the need for clearer policies and better refugee management are addressed. The speaker urges stronger coordination, clearer funding, and decisive actions for handling refugees, suggesting options like resettlement or voluntary repatriation.

Q & A
What are the transportation options for traveling to Rempa from Kalimantan Barat?
-There are two main options: a 10-hour sea journey or a combination of air, land, and sea travel, which takes about 5 hours.
What is the current staffing situation at the Aceh immigration office?
-The Aceh immigration office has 32 staff members, but they are currently sharing office space since they do not yet have their own building.
How many immigration offices are there in the Aceh region, and what are their classifications?
-There are six immigration offices in Aceh, classified as follows: one Class 1 TPI office in Banda Aceh, three Class 2 TPI offices in Langsa, Sabang, and Lhokseumawe, one non-TPI office in Melaboh, and one Class 3 non-TPI office in Takengon.
How does the Aceh immigration office monitor immigration activities?
-The Aceh immigration office conducts monitoring through TPI, collaboration with other agencies, technology, reporting systems for foreigners, and public awareness campaigns.
What challenges does the Aceh immigration office face in managing the vast geographical area?
-The office covers 23 districts and cities, with significant travel times between locations, such as an 8â9 hour trip from Banda Aceh to Langsa, and up to 12 hours to some remote areas like Pulau Simeulue.
What actions does the Aceh immigration office take to prevent human trafficking and exploitation?
-The office focuses on thorough investigations, cooperation with other agencies, intelligence strengthening, and public education on avoiding involvement in human trafficking and exploitation.
How many cases of delayed passport issuance or departure have been recorded by the Aceh immigration office?
-A total of 699 cases have been recorded, with the Langsa office delaying 680 cases and the Takengon office 19 cases.
What is the Aceh immigration officeâs approach to forming community awareness programs?
-The office has established 'Desa Binaan' (model villages) in 11 villages, focusing on educating communities to avoid becoming victims of human trafficking and exploitation.
What is the current situation regarding the Rohingya refugee camps in Aceh?
-There are four refugee camps in Aceh, with a total of around 1,104 Rohingya refugees. The camps are in Lhokseumawe, Aceh Timur, Desa Kule Pid, and Desa Minaraya Pid.
What are the reasons behind the arrival of Rohingya refugees in Aceh?
-The refugees are fleeing violence, discrimination, and persecution in Myanmar, and Aceh is geographically close, with a history of providing humanitarian assistance to refugees.
